Welsh starlet Daniel James has withdrawn from his nation’s training camp following the sudden death of his father.
The 21-year-old had been named in the group due to train in Portugal, but is now understood to have not travelled.
James’ club, Swansea City, released a statement expressing their condolences on Thursday:
“Everyone at Swansea City has been saddened to hear of the sudden passing of Daniel James’ father.
“Everyone at the football club send their condolences and our thoughts are with Daniel and his family at this sad time.”
James has been twice capped for Wales, who will travel to Croatia and Hungary for back-to-back Euro 2020 qualifiers next month.
The winger, reportedly the subject of a £15 million bid from Manchester United, registered five goals and 10 assists in 38 appearances this season.
